Multi-agent systems are increasingly being used in complex applications due to features such as autonomy, proactivity, flexibility, robustness and social ability. However, these very features also make verifying multi-agent systems a challenging task. In this paper, we propose a mechanism, including automated tool support, for early phase defect detection by comparing agent interaction specifications with the detailed design of the agents participating in the interactions. The basic intuition of our approach is to extract sets of possible traces from the agent design and to verify whether these traces conform to the protocol specifications. Our approach is based on the Prometheus agent design methodology but is applicable to other similar methodologies. Our initial evaluation shows that even simple protocols developed by relatively experienced developers are prone to defects, and our approach is successful in uncovering some of these defects.
